Last night I started and finished Bound on PS4, the game is one of these artsy indies but with actual platforming. It's not the best platforming by any means but does add more of a game around the central films whilst you play as ballerina with some of the best animation in gaming.

The rest of the game is nice part from one thing which I won't go into because spoilers, out of the recent of indies I've played this is better then Beyond Eyes but worse then ABZU.

7/10

Ratchet & Clank (PS4)

So I beat this in the early hours this morning, all the characters have a fun charm to them - Clank especially was a big favourite & the weapons are great to use but I just wish the game leaned more to the exploring platformer side of things rather it's shooting side.

It done this once about almost half way into the game on a planet called Gaspar & it was by far my favourite level in the game, fun overall but I think most games journalists blew this up to be much better than it actually is.

Golden Sun

Last Game You Finished and Your Thoughts MKII - Page 30 Hqdefault

Slow to get going, poor at explaining itself and text heavy, Golden Sun nevertheless manages to be a lot of fun. The combat system is very rich - I might go so far as to say "the Bravely Default of its day" - with numerous bonuses and joys to find if you experiment with different combinations of stat- and magic-boosting sprites called 'Djinn'. Storyline OK to good, though the game really is just getting into its stride when the credits roll. Ho hum.

14/20

I just beat the final boss in Ape Escape 2, a PS2 Classic on PS4. I suggested that everybody go download it in another thread, before I'd played it for the first time in over a decade. Aye, well, nostalgia is a bastart. The gadgets, locations, unlockables and especially the music aren't as good as I remembered, and the camera and controls definitely shows the game's age ...but still, it has a very unique personality that makes it just about makes it worth a download, if you're into your 3D platformers. Just understand that it's 2016, and not 2003. I rate it a low-ish 7/10.

Nova-111

Last Game You Finished and Your Thoughts MKII - Page 30 2015-08-26-114359

A neat RTS with a big dash of puzzling elements, Nova-111 is a lot of fun with a mild tendency to frustrate. You control a small spaceship whose mission it is to rescue scientists stranded around the levels as a result of an explosive accident. You move about the grid whilst various beasties and bots do the same; the twist is that some enemy actions are turn-based whilst some take place in real-time. Figuring out what to do to proceed was involving though, as with most downloadable titles, things just start to really get going and then it ends. Nonetheless a great morsel of gaming entertainment. Recommended.

16/20

Asdivine Hearts

Last Game You Finished and Your Thoughts MKII - Page 30 Cover_medium

A Wii U eShop JRPG par excellence... at least, that's what I thought after a few hours. Then the game's issues start to betray it: the translation is occasionally off and the controls sometimes don't respond properly. Poochy & Balladeer would retch at the generic five or six tunes that play out over the game's 32 hours (on my playthrough, at least). The palette swapping monsters begin to bore you and the utterly game-breaking boss-beating technique means none of the fights are threatening until the very end. That said, the jaunty story - the world's Light Deity is being hunted down by the Shadow Deity and, weakened, ends up in the body of a cat; hijinks ensue - and reasonable gameplay mean it's almost worth genre fans checking it out. Others will not be converted.

12/20

Not much to be said about this one. I did only beat Bowser with 60 stars but I'll count it as "finishing", rather than "completing". I've been playing this alongside the sequel (have about 30 stars on Galaxy 2 atm) so I've been experiencing them as one package really, and together they are probably my favourite game of all time. I say probably, because I've not seen everything they have to offer yet, and likely never will given just how many more stars there are in those games. If I was 10-15 years younger and could plough hours in to these every evening, I feel they'd leave a deeper mark on me, but the fact that the first Galaxy has wowed me consistently, nine years after its release is testament to how timeless the game already is.

Favourite levels: anything involving water. These all seemed so peaceful (which took me back to chilling out in Dire, Dire Docks in Mario 64). I've always enjoyed the water levels in Mario games (loved Sunshine's hub area) but Galaxy felt less punishing the deeper you went underwater. I also really enjoyed the desert levels, which are normally the ones I most fear.

If I was to be picky, I could do without Spring Mario and there did seem to be a lot of races. Also the final battle with Bowser was easy, although the level getting to Bowser had me clawing my eyes out. Lava will be (and has been NUMEROUS times) the death of me.

Nevertheless, I look forward to beating Galaxy 2 and chipping away at the remaining stars.

10/10

Galaxy 1 was the s***! The second ever platformer (Crash Bandicoot 3 was the first) I ever collected everything in, brilliant game that somehow managed to avoid the trap of having too many collectables set behind chore levels!

Can't say I enjoyed the second Galaxy that much alas. I feel that where the first Galaxy made most of its levels a blast Galaxy 2 had a bit too many that felt like a chore to play, and the really good ones were often on the shorter side. Combine that with the harsher star requirements to progress and, well, lets just say I doubt Nintendo will ever top the first Galaxy.
